Bristol Water Meter Application Experiences

I wondered if anybody has any, whether it be:

How long it took to send a surveyor around.

How long they took to fit a meter and in the event that they took more than the maximum time permitted to fit the meter and no water charges was applying until it was fitted at what point do they refund apparent overpayments that have been made.

    Metering is done through the same system for Bristol Water as for Wessex so I would guess the same things apply.

    Wessex is currently experiencing a real backlog in water meter installations so it may easily be 30 days or more until you get a meter fitted.

    A temporary stop is put on a customer's account once the 30 days from receipt of application pass so you would not be billed but getting overpayments back out of them will always be a hassle...

    Its actually 60 working days for applications made during certain months.

    True Bristol Water And Wessex Water now share its billing, in Bristol Meter applications are dealt with by Bristol Water. I made a meter application around 20th March, BW waited till 14th May to write to me offering a surveyor appointment for 4th June, 1st July normal water direct debit was still taken. :mad:
